Hp Laserjet 1200 – Printer With Attachable Copier/ Scanner

In the line of the HP LaserJet 1100xi, and the original HP LaserJet 1000, stands as a great improvement over its predecessors, and a speedy device for its price range. High quality resolution and fast processing speed make this unique printer combination worth checking out, but especially notable is the 1200's optional hardware accessory that converts it into a three in one unit.

Though the HP LaserJet 1200 is exclusively a monochrome device, its resolution of 1200 x 1200 dots per inch is notable and, while not ideal for photographs, should prove to be effective in producing crystal clear graphs and charts. Its speed also helps it stand out among personal laser devices; clocking in at an advertised 15 pages per minute maximum.

With both USB and Parallel ports incorporated into the unit, the HP LaserJet 1200 can function on both Mac OS and Windows based PCs. It does sit with a curiously large footprint of 16.3 inches by a whopping 19.2 inches, but this is mostly due to the strange, duckbill looking paper tray that protrudes from the device. Its height is quite admirable, barely squeezing in under 9.9 inches, and its weight of 18.3 pounds is at least decent considering the hardware specifications.
